More about Drigetti

So, you want to know more about the Drigus. The first thing to remember is that the proper plural of Drigus is Drigetti. Drigetti are very sensitive about this point, so remember it.

Drigetti seem to be a mix between tigers, dragons, and horses. I'm not sure quite how this happened, but I think it has something to do with magic. Drigetti are moody creatures, and tend to be territorial. They are all omnivores, but usually prefere meat. Drigetti spend most of their time on the ground, but they do have wings, and will often hunt from the air. They have excellent vision, and they are able to breath fire.

While most Drigetti show the influence of all three animals that went into their making, individuals tend to show the influence of one animal more than the others. Drigetti do have some traits that are more likely to show up than others. Any particular Drigus trait can be either recessive, dominante, or superdominant (meaning that it will "hide" even dominant genes). Some drigetti traits have a super-recessive option as well. Most of the herd presently available for breeding in our adoption program have a lot of hidden recessive genes. For this reason, when you choose on the adoption form which mare to use, you are choosing not what your drigus WILL look like, but what the POSSIBILITIES are.

Drigetti go through four major stages in their development towards adulthood. These stages are egg, hatchling, youth, and adult.
